Nothing Really Matters - Sick Puppies(2000)
Shot and edited by Phil Moore
Shot during the week the band Sick Puppies won Triple-J Sydney Unearthed (2000). This was the first single from this young band and shows them in their early days in Australia. The footage comes from the Unearthed Showcase concert at the Hordern Pavilion, and a gig later that same night at the Iron Duke Hotel, in Sydney. It was put together as part of a documentary on the whole Unearthed week for the band.

The Bobsy Boys(2004)
Written, Produced,
Directed & Edited by Phil Moore
Synopsis The story of a gay couple who have together brought up a son. Now one of them is dying of cancer.
Finalist in the Melbourne Queer Film Festival 2004; Finalist in the Newcastle Film Festival 2004 (where Mark Jensen - that's him on the left - won Best Actor for his performance); Runner-up Best Film at the 2004 QuickFlicks Festival. Also featured in the Frame By Frame AIDS charity festival, and selected for NAFA ShowFest
